The state of the nation, By Jibrin Ibrahim, et al.

The article reflects on the annulled election of June 12, 1993, in Nigeria, noting that 33 years have passed since the event. It highlights that the median age of Nigerians is 18, implying many younger citizens may not fully grasp the historical significance of the election.
